Printing machine assistants vs Purchasing managers and directors Salary (2025)
How do Printing machine assistants and Purchasing managers and directors salaries compare in the UK? Here is a detailed side-by-side breakdown.
Purchasing managers and directors earns £29,403 more per year (98% higher)
Detailed Comparison
| Metric | Printing machine assistants | Purchasing managers and directors | Difference |
|---|---|---|---|
| Median Annual | £30,061 | £59,464 | -£29,403 |
| Mean Annual | £31,725 | £62,204 | -£30,479 |
| Monthly | £2,505 | £4,955 | -£2,450 |
| Weekly | £578 | £1,144 | -£566 |
| Hourly | £14.45 | £28.59 | -£14.14 |
